hebrew #2052 - וָהֵב Vaheb (perhaps a place in Moab)
Strong's Exhaustive Concordance what he did Of uncertain derivation; Vaheb, a place in Moab -- what he did. Englishman's Concordance Vaheb of Waheb=“now, come on: and do thou give” 1) a place in Moab, site unknown Part of Speech: noun proper locative A Related Word by BDB/Strong’s Number: of uncertain derivation Brown-Driver-Briggsוָהֵב, apparently proper name, of a location, אֶתוָֿהֵב בְּסוּפָהNumbers 21:14, object of a verb now lost out of the text (compare RV & especially Di VB), situation unknown; ᵐ5Ζωοβ, Ζοοβ; so LagBN 54 SayAcademy (London).
